CEIS is seeking an experienced Safety Manager to support complex construction projects across multiple business units. This role is responsible for leading safety performance, supporting field operations, and driving a proactive safety culture across project teams. The ideal candidate brings strong field leadership, technical safety expertise,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in dynamic, high-risk construction environments.

This individual will serve as a key safety resource at the project, operational, and organizational levelsensuring compliance, mentoring teams, and continuously improving safety performance across all phases of construction.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and support site safety programs across multiple projects, ensuring compliance with OSHA, client, and company standards
  • Conduct regular field safety inspections, audits, and assessments to identify risks and drive corrective actions
  • Analyze safety data, trends, and incident reports to improve overall safety performance and develop targeted solutions
  • Support and mentor project teams, subcontractors, and safety staff on best practices, hazard recognition, and compliance expectations
  • Lead incident investigations, root cause analysis, and implementation of corrective actions
  • Develop, review, and implement Site-Specific Safety Plans (SSSPs), Job Hazard Analyses (JHAs), and safety procedures
  • Facilitate safety meetings, toolbox talks, and project safety orientations
  • Collaborate with project teams during preconstruction to support safety planning and risk mitigation strategies
  • Evaluate subcontractor safety performance and ensure adherence to project safety requirements
  • Coordinate and deliver safety training, including just-in-time training for high-risk activities
  • Serve as a technical safety resource for field teams and leadership
  • Support emergency response efforts and crisis management as needed
  • Maintain accurate safety documentation, reporting, and compliance records
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of safety programs, processes, and corporate initiatives

Qualifications

  • Bachelors degree in Safety, Construction Management, or related field preferred
  • 5 years of construction safety experience (8 years in lieu of degree)
  • Professional certification preferred (CHST, CSP, or equivalent)
  • OSHA 30 required; OSHA 500 preferred
  • First Aid/CPR certification
  • Strong knowledge of OSHA regulations and high-risk construction activities (fall protection, excavation, cranes, electrical, scaffolding)
  • Proven experience conducting inspections, audits, and incident investigations
  • Ability to manage multiple projects, priorities, and deadlines
  • Strong commun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work independently and in team environments
  • Willingness to travel or support project-based work as needed
